Your doctor will conduct a thorough evaluation to determine if you suffer from adult ADHD. These tests will examine the patient's past history of symptoms and other factors, including family history of mental illness.

Interviews will be conducted with the person suffering from ADHD as well as others who are close to them. They will ask the person with ADHD questions about how their symptoms affect their lives at school, at work, as well as with friends and family.

A doctor might also ask the individual to fill out an ADHD rating scale which is a list of questions designed to measure ADHD symptoms. These questionnaires can be completed by the person or a person who is close to them or a certified professional.

The majority of these ADHD rating scales require a few minutes to complete. They ask the user to rate the frequency of certain signs, like being distracted or unable pay attention to a task.

One of the more common ADHD assessment tools is the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der Symptom Assessment Scale (ASRS). This tool measures 18 different symptoms and allows the user to determine how often they feel them on a scale from "never" to "very often." Counseling

Many people suffering from ADHD are frustrated and find it difficult to cope with their symptoms. There are a variety of effective ways to help.

Individual talk therapy: This type of counseling involves talking with an experienced therapist who will provide assistance and guidance as you process your emotions and concerns. It is especially beneficial when you are struggling with negative feelings like self-esteem issues or feeling that you don't measure with other people.

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a kind of talk therapy is designed to change patterns of thinking and behavior. It can help you to reframe your thoughts and actions, to make them more productive and less disruptive.

CBT could also be helpful if you want to improve your organizational skills and boost your self-esteem. If you are struggling to control your anger or managing your impulses, CBT could be helpful.

Psychiatric medication: This drug can be very effective in managing ADHD symptoms. In addition it can be utilized as part of an overall treatment plan for ADHD including counseling and enhancing your diet and exercise.

Other types of counseling include marriage and family therapy. This kind of therapy can help your spouse and you understand each more effectively and improve communication in the relationship.

Another form of counseling for adults with ADHD is called behavior therapy. Behavioral therapy provides patients with strategies to deal with the daily issues of living with ADHD. They learn to set goals and manage time and money more effectively, and enhance their ability to organize their lives.

These strategies can be helpful for people suffering from ADHD. However they are particularly beneficial to adults who have had issues with self-esteem or other issues. Therapists during sessions can determine the primary beliefs that are driving their negative thoughts and actions.

Neurofeedback: Brain training is another effective treatment for people with ADHD that can help reduce impulsive and distractible behavior. Through a variety of brain exercises, neurofeedback trains people to create brain waves that reflect the focus.
